Context
Social Supermarket is the fastest growing sustainable gifting and branded merchandise provider in the UK. We believe in the power of impactful & personalised gifts to drive deeper connections and our vision is to become the UK’s most trusted supplier of impact led products. Our goal is to help clients “ditch the disposable” and move away from unremarkable and wasteful branded merchandise towards unique and impactful merchandise with high “desk presence”.

In particular, branded merchandise has been our fastest growing product category in the last two years and we are now looking to scale this up. We partner with hundreds of clients who are looking for sustainable alternatives to traditional wasteful merchandise. For every order we also offer clients a personalised impact report that translates their purchases to positive social and environmental impact.

We’re looking to hire an experienced sales person who is keen to work with impact led products and whose role will be focused on providing branded merchandise and gifting solutions to our top corporate customers. This person should be able to demonstrate a track record of selling branded merchandise and / or gifting to larger corporate clients. This could be a role for you if you are someone with a passion for purpose led challenger brands and excited at the prospect to roll up your sleeves in an entrepreneurial setting.

Job Description:
As an account manager for merchandise and gifting, you will be working with an existing book of our largest corporate clients, looking to expand and deepen these existing relationships, including targeting to become the dedicated supplier of merchandise and gifting.

You will be sourcing and presenting the most exciting products that also have tangible social or environmental impact. Think branded plants that empower women in prison to notebooks made from stone that fund clean drinking water projects. Working closely with our partners and internal teams, you will champion our sustainable products, fostering strong relationships and driving sales performance to achieve ambitious targets.

Key Responsibilities:
● Deepen and expand relationships with an existing book of our largest clients.
● Look to become the sole branded merchandise and gifting provider with these clients
● Attend client and networking events, building relationships with senior stakeholders and buyers.
● Inspire clients with social impact stories and reporting
● Work with our Head of Brand & Marketing to promote good news stories
● Work with our Operations team to ensure smooth delivery of products
● Source new merchandise product ideas
● Mentor and educate junior members of the sales team on sales best practices

Key Skills and Qualifications:
● Proven Track Record of Sales achievement with large clients
● Experience working as an Account Manager (or similar) in branded merchandise or gifting
● Excellent communication and negotiation skills, with the ability to build rapport and influence decision-makers.
● Analytical mindset with proficiency in sales data analysis and performance tracking.
● Strong presentation skills
● Adaptability and resilience to thrive in a fast-paced, evolving start-up environment.
● A passion for sustainability and social impact

You’d be working alongside
You’ll be joining a small, driven team with high aspirations for our company and the impact it can have, including three other employees and three co-founders with professional backgrounds and experience in sustainability, financial planning, strategy and software development.

In June 2020, we successfully raised seed investment. In 2021 we became B Corp certified and in both 2022 and 2023 we were announced as one of the Escape100, the top 100 companies to work at based on mission, impact and more.
